Know Your Logs: Materials, Age, and Existing Damage

Not every log home is the same. Some are newer builds, while others have been standing for decades. The materials used, how the cabin was built, and the current condition of the logs all play a role in how we approach each project.

Older homes might have logs that show signs of rot, insect damage, or UV wear. Others may have thick layers of old stain hiding issues underneath. We always begin with a full inspection. This helps us understand what your home needs and lets us plan each step of the project correctly.

The Staining Process in Mountain Climate Zones Like Kingsport

Weather plays a big part in how long stain lasts and how well it holds up. In Kingsport, the mix of humidity, sunlight, and seasonal changes can wear down even high-quality stains over time. That’s why stain choice and preparation are important.

We begin by removing old finishes using media blasting or sanding. This step clears away buildup and gets the logs ready for treatment. Once the surface is clean, we help you choose a stain that fits your style and will hold up in this climate. Finally, we apply the new stain and seal it properly to protect the wood and keep it looking good.
